Rasharkin, a small town in County Antrim, north of Ballymena, recently played host to a Gluten Free Information Evening, organised by Kennedy’s Pharmacy. Opened in 1997, Kennedy’s is the towns’ and surrounding areas’ source of gluten free food on prescription.
Around a dozen local and national brands took part in providing information and samples of gluten free food to over one hundred visitors who attended the evening.
The Millside Restaurant from nearby Cloughmills, provided free catering for the night and was very well received with their dedicated and adaptable gluten free menus.
Gluten Free Ireland took a table for the evening to provide information on where to eat out locally and to highlight the many gluten free brands now available, alongside a range of nutritional information providers, cake producers, local shops and national brands.
